Added xsd:date type and DateTypeConverter

This commit is contained in:
Francis Besset
2011-08-29 21:34:49 +02:00
parent b4da2f727e
commit c18cede7ab
5 changed files with 95 additions and 1 deletions

View File

@ -7,6 +7,7 @@
<parameters>
<parameter key="besimple.soap.converter.repository.class">BeSimple\SoapBundle\Converter\ConverterRepository</parameter>
<parameter key="besimple.soap.converter.date_time.class">BeSimple\SoapBundle\Converter\DateTimeTypeConverter</parameter>
<parameter key="besimple.soap.converter.date.class">BeSimple\SoapBundle\Converter\DateTypeConverter</parameter>
</parameters>
<services>
@ -15,5 +16,9 @@
<service id="besimple.soap.converter.date_time" class="%besimple.soap.converter.date_time.class%" public="false">
<tag name="besimple.soap.converter" />
</service>
<service id="besimple.soap.converter.date" class="%besimple.soap.converter.date.class%" public="false">
<tag name="besimple.soap.converter" />
</service>
</services>
</container>

View File

@ -81,6 +81,10 @@
<argument>dateTime</argument>
<argument>xsd:dateTime</argument>
</call>
<call method="addDefaultTypeMapping">
<argument>date</argument>
<argument>xsd:date</argument>
</call>
</service>
</services>